What is Web Scraping?

Web scraping refers to the extraction of data from a website into a new format. In most cases, the data from a website is extracted into an Excel sheet or JSON file.

Web scraping is usually an automated process done by a piece of software, although it can still be done manually. As a result, most people prefer to use web scraping software to save time and money.

What is Web Scraping Used For?

Due to its versatility, web scraping can be used in various scenarios. We could spend hours reviewing each use case, but here are some of the most common.

Lead Generation

Imagine that you are working for a company that sells and distributes dental equipment for dentists. As a result, you might be interested in creating a database or spreadsheet with information about every dentist in your city.

You could create this spreadsheet manually, one by one, or you could use a web scraper to scrape a website like Yellow Pages or Yelp for information on dentist offices. Including their business names, addresses, phone numbers and more.

Competitor Analysis / Market Research

Let’s say you are looking into starting your own e-commerce business by selling smartphone cases online. Therefore, building a database of similar product listings can provide you with insights on how to position and price your products.

For example, you could scrape Amazon and eBay listings for phone cases in order to build your database of competitor products.

Statistical Analysis

Many people use web scraping to generate datasets they can later use for statistical analysis.

For example, you could use a web scraper to extract stock prices for specific companies on a daily basis and get a better sense of how a specific industry is performing overall.

On the other hand, you could also use web scraping for more “fun” statistical analysis, such as scraping sports stats that will fuel your fantasy league choices.

Other Uses

As we mentioned earlier, there are many more uses for web scraping, including:

  • Social Media scraping for sentiment analysis
  • Scraping for archival purposes
  • Scraping websites for research purposes
  • Scraping your own site before a website migration
  • Scraping data for comparison shopping
